Yet to see it, but social media in a bit of frenzy as it's seen by critics and fans alike as one of these best TV shows ever. I believe it's currently the highest rated series on IMDB at 9.7/10. Stars Jared Harris, Emily Watson and Stellan Skarsgard.

Trailer looks horrific. Really dig the use of the geiger counter reading seemingly intertwined with the score. Bit like Atonement, where a typewriter is used as an instrument.
